Output 27b94de763ccf4e3b39dd31384f2f961e56fac584f89251e5f9230e8f29a401c:0

value
1287605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 726238ab9b83103c97313f3abe52a2af8a64771c OP_EQUAL
address
3C7pcxDJP3Hy25Sskg9f7qqKUGgNyP7iLz
transaction
27b94de763ccf4e3b39dd31384f2f961e56fac584f89251e5f9230e8f29a401c
confirmations
299958
spent
true